Match Day Preview: Plymouth Argyle v Cheltenham Town

Plymouth Argyle v Cheltenham Town

League Two, Saturday 6th April 2013, 3pm

Argyle manager John Sheridan will be looking for his team to put Monday's defeat at York behind them as they face another vital game against Cheltenham today.

The relegation battle in League Two is a remarkably close affair with eight teams within four points of one another and still in danger. The Pilgrims are one, lying just above the drop zone and only one point clear while Cheltenham sit comfortably in the play-off places in 4th with a chance of still making the automatic promotion spots.

The Robins arrive at Home Park on the back of a 1-0 win against Norhtampton on Monday.

Plymouth will hope to draw upon their confidence boosting derby victory against Exeter last weekend but know they face a tough game against a good side looking for 3 points themselves.
